Cyrus Gordon, in Before Columbus (Crown, 1970, page108) says that Plato
in Timaeus makes reference to a continent that seals off the Ocean to
the west (America). Gordon does not give a reference in Timaeus so I am
having difficulty finding it. I tried looking up HPEIROS in LSJ to see
if there was a citation in Timaeus. This didn't produce anything.

Anyone have an idea what this reference might be?

I will go play with Persus and see what I find but I don't have much to
go on.
